House siding replacement involves removing existing siding materials and installing new, durable siding to improve the appearance and functionality of a home's exterior. This service typically includes assessing the current siding condition, removing damaged or outdated materials, preparing the surface, and carefully installing new siding options such as vinyl, fiber cement, or wood. The goal is to create a weather-resistant barrier that enhances curb appeal while providing long-lasting protection against the elements.
Replacing siding can help solve several common problems homeowners face, including issues with moisture intrusion, mold growth, and pest infiltration. Over time, siding can become warped, cracked, or faded, reducing its effectiveness and aesthetic appeal. In some cases, siding may no longer meet current building standards or homeowner preferences, making replacement a practical solution. Upgrading siding can also impro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ation, which may lead to lower heating and cooling costs.

The overview below groups typical House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bus,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s in Columbus often range from $250-$600, covering patching, replacing small sections, or fixing damaged panels.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ching higher costs.
Standard Replacement - Full siding replacements for average-sized homes usually c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Local contractors often see projects in this range, though larger or more complex homes can push costs higher.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ive siding upgrades or custom installations in larger homes can exceed $15,000, especially if premium materials or intricate designs are involved. These projects are less common but represent the top tier of typical costs.
Material Variations - The choice of siding material impacts costs significantly, with vinyl siding generally costing $3-$7 per square foot, while fiber cement or wood options can range from $8-$15 per square foot. Material selection can influence the overall project budget."
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
